What to read after Life of Pi

Books matched by the same qualities that made Life of Pi unforgettable: mysterious & atmospheric tone, balanced pacing, and themes of Survival and Identity.

Where the Crawdads Sing cover
01 Where the Crawdads Sing Delia Owens

A girl abandoned by her family grows up alone in the North Carolina marshes -- then becomes the prime suspect in a murder.

02 Daughter of Smoke and Bone Laini Taylor

Karou has blue hair, a sketchbook full of monsters, and a life she doesn't fully understand. The teeth her chimaera family collects are currency in a world she's never seen. Until she does.

03 The Shadow of the Wind Carlos Ruiz Zafon

A boy in post-war Barcelona discovers a forgotten novel, then discovers that someone has been systematically destroying every book the author ever wrote.

04 The Virgin Suicides Jeffrey Eugenides

The neighbourhood boys spend the rest of their lives trying to understand the five Lisbon sisters, whose deaths they witnessed and could not prevent.

05 The Color Purple Alice Walker

Celie writes letters she cannot send to a God she is not sure is listening -- and slowly, through those letters, she finds her voice and her life.
